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Minster to Ince (Manchester) start from as little as £49.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Minster to Ince (Manchester) start from £101.90 one way, or £145.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Minster to Ince (Manchester) are available for £238.50 one way, or £477.00 return

Facilities and Amenities

Minster station is equipped with ticket machines that cater to online ticket collections, making the preparation for your journey seamless. While the station does not have a ticket office, the presence of accessible ticket machines, conveniently positioned by the entrance to platform 2, makes it easy for everyone, including those with accessibility needs, to secure their train tickets. Though there is no luggage storage, waiting rooms, or refreshment options, the station still manages to provide essential services. You'll find customer help points available to ensure your questions are answered, and a helpline is at hand for any additional support.

Regarding accessibility, Minster station has partial step-free access under category B1. You can expect step-free travel towards London via a railway foot crossing. While not staffed, help from Southeastern's mobile assistance team can be arranged in advance for those needing additional support. Although there are no dedicated station staff, assistance is available directly on the trains, promising smooth boarding and disembarking.

Transport Connectivity

For those who wish to explore beyond the local area, Minster station's convenient transport links are sure to please. The rail replacement service and buses can be accessed from the car park at the front of the station, providing alternatives during service disruptions. Facilities and Features

Although there's no staffed ticket office, Ince (Manchester) provides user-friendly ticket machines enabling hassle-free ticket collection. The machines are fully accessible, ensuring all passengers have a smooth experience when selecting and retrieving tickets. Given the station’s unstaffed nature, commuters needing information can contact the customer helpline or use available help points. While there aren’t lounge or waiting room facilities, seating areas on the platform offer a place to rest before your train departs.

Accessibility, however, can be a challenge at this Category B station. Step-free access is limited, and travelers should note that no tactile paving is present. For those requiring additional support, assistance booking through the Passenger Assist service is available, with boarding ramps on trains to ease getting on and off.

Connections and Onward Travel

For those who need a convenient, onward transport option from Ince, a host of alternatives lie within a short distance. Buses are available on both sides of Ince Green Lane, providing easy journeys to Wigan, Leigh, or Hindley. Taxis can be arranged through Cab4You, offering another handy way to transfer to your next destination or complete the first mile of your journey.

Even if rail services are suddenly disrupted, the rail replacement service at Ince (Manchester) makes getting to your destination a more straightforward task. Simply turn left at the station's entrance, and 200 yards along Ince Green Lane you’ll find service bus stops outside the Ince Green Store.
